					Green Party co-leader Jeanette Fitzsimons has told Carbon News she will not back off a proposed 10 year ban on new baseload thermal power generation.
She said she had worked on it with Climate Change Minister David Parker in the context of the goal of 90% renewable power generation by 2025 - and was confident it will not add to costs.
